    1Complete the Online ApplicationAll Grace College applicants must submit official high school transcripts. The transcripts must come directly from your high school or universityAll applicants must submit an official copy of either SAT, ACT or TOEFL scoresProvide a copy of your passportFill out the Declaration of Financial Support Form demonstrating financial resources to enroll. This form must be notarized
